CVE-2011-2696

24
FAUCET Score

CVE-2011-2696 describes an integer overflow vulnerability in libsndfile versions prior to 1.0.25, specifically affecting the mega_nerd libsndfile product. This flaw allows remote attackers to trigger a heap-based buffer overflow by providing a specially crafted PARIS Audio Format (PAF) file. The vulnerability has a CVSS score of 6.8, indicating a medium severity risk, as it can lead to a denial of service (application crash) or potentially arbitrary code execution. There is no evidence of active exploitation, nor is exploit code publicly available on platforms like Metasploit or ExploitDB, and it has received minimal community discussion or media coverage.
